THE MISSION STARTS Then, with a shifting of the wind, a song was blown to them from the bunk-house, a cheerful, ringing chorus; the sound was like daylight--it drove the terror from the room.

Joe Cumberland asked them to leave him.
That night, he said, he would sleep.

He felt it, like a promise.

The other three went out from the room.
In the hall Kate and Daniels stood close together under a faint light from the wall-lamp, and they talked as if they had forgotten the presence of Byrne.
"It had to come," she said.

"I knew it would come to him sooner or later, but I didn't dream it would be as terrible as this.
